Output 66a5ad353a832c49346660fdd94ece8053e4b790ff8d88d75f7143593ba2cd46:2

value
1230406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ff69ab96da5929233410431c4fdd394b540a904d OP_EQUAL
address
3QyWpZQqWrB5N3MaZPLh5jfmY7v3w2PMeG
transaction
66a5ad353a832c49346660fdd94ece8053e4b790ff8d88d75f7143593ba2cd46
spent
true